One oriented in industrial history may notice how well the geographic pattern of monochronic and polychronic cultures correlate with the early industrialization over the globe. Halls first distance is referred to as intimate space and is often referred to as our personal bubble. This bubble ranges from 0 to 18 inches from the body. You will notice that, as the distances move further away from the body, the intimacy of interactions decreases.
